Please join us on April 16, 2013 for our monthly

luncheon, where we will have Alan Bush, a local attorney who

specializes in labor and employment law, speak to us about

non-competes.

Alan Bush counsels business leaders. He focuses on labor and

employment law, often litigating disputes against employees. Alan also

helps businesses with HR policies. Super Lawyers recently named Alan

to its Rising Stars list.

Alan has spoken and published for many business organizations.

For example, the Houston CPA Society named him Speaker of the Year

2010-2011. The Gulf Coast Symposium and HR Southwest have both

tapped Alan as a speaker. And he has spoken for The Woodlands and

Montgomery County Bar Associations. Finally ,Alan is a guest columnist

for The Houston Business Journal and Texas Lawyer.

NEW DAY FOR NON-COMPETES:

SECURE YOUR INVESTMENT IN HUMAN CAPITAL You invest in human capital. You share the ball—employees learn

your secret playbook and leverage your customer goodwill. Both

investments, thanks to Marsh v. Cook, can now justify roping an

employee into a reasonable non-compete. We'll talk it out. And we'll

discuss how to avoid winding up on the wrong end of a non-compete

enforcement action when you hire from a competitor.

From the President’s Desk

By

Craig Splawn

You would think that with everything that is going on with the

implementation of healthcare reform that I would not have any trouble writing

an article each month but, guess what, here I am struggling again.

I think that the most pressing issue that is on my mind right now, and I hope is on your

minds too, is the growth and perpetuation of this chapter for years to come. I found out the week

before last that HAHU is no longer the largest chapter in the universe. Philadelphia has moved

into that position. My first reaction was that I have really let you, the members, down. For some

reason I have been unable to lead our board and membership in a manner that would promote the

true value that NAHU, TAHU, and HAHU bring to our members. I can think of numerous reasons

for this as the carriers, TPA’s, and brokers are all restructuring their business module so that they

feel they can survive whatever the final implementation of the ACA looks like. Some of that

restructuring requires cutbacks. However, I choose not to use those reasons as I feel that right

now is when we should all work together and learn from each other’s strong points. It is our

responsibility to make each other aware of any informational opportunities that will enhance our

ability to serve our clients in a manner that will bring value to that relationship. One of the strong

points of being a member of this chapter is the communication between members regarding ideas

that one member feels would benefit another member, whether that idea is from a carrier, TPA,

GA, or another broker. There is strength in numbers. Those of you that make the trip to Day at

the Capitol in Austin or CAP Conference in D. C. each year actually see that working as you visit

with your elected officials. Now is the time to work together with our current membership so as

to grow it and strengthen it for the future of our industry. Personally, without the support of our

carrier members, the TPA’s and GA’s that are members, and my fellow brokers that are members, I

would not feel that I would be able to advise my clients on how they will be affected by the ACA

and how best to structure their benefits for the changing times.

So, I am asking each of you to let me know how HAHU can help you and your business. If

you truly feel that our association brings value to you, then ask a fellow broker to become a

member. Get involved in our chapter and learn more about what it can do for you. Don’t forget

that we are in need of members to take an active role in our board for this next year. If you feel

that you are ready to try to help our industry and our members please contact either myself, Jeff

Bacot, or Terrell Rogers. I can be reached at 713-785-3290 or [email protected]. I

welcome your thoughts and your suggestions on what we can do to enhance the value of your

HAHU membership.

Association CE Credit

Many agents may not know that up to four hours of continuing education credit can be earned by an agent who is an active member of a state or national insurance association. For information about how the credit can be earned, you can review Chapter 4004.0535 of the Texas Insurance Code and §19.1011 and new §19.1020 of the Texas Administrative Code. The form can be found at: http://www.tdi.texas.gov/forms/lhllicensing/LHL617reqassocc.pdf and on page 18 of this newsletter.
